When relaxation faces the mountains
Opened in 2000, Balnéa was the first thermal water relaxation center in the Pyrénées. It uses naturally warm water from nearby hot springs to feed its many pools.

The complex features several areas inspired by different bathing traditions from around the world: the Roman baths, with heated indoor and outdoor pools, the Native American space, focused on relaxation and nature, the Japanese baths, offering stunning mountain views, the Tibetan area, dedicated to deep relaxation, and a family-friendly space.
Some outdoor pools allow you to soak facing the snow-capped Pyrenees in winter or the lush green mountains in summer, making this experience a true highlight of the place.

A wellness destination all year round
Thanks to its naturally warm mineral-rich waters, Balnéa welcomes visitors and wellness seekers looking for relaxation, sports recovery, or a soothing break. The center, located by the Génos-Loudenvielle lake, also offers saunas, hammams, body treatments, and massages along with aquatic activities for children.

Nestled right next to the ski resorts of the Louron valley, Balnéa has become a must-visit spot after a day in the mountains. Some resorts even offer packages that include ski passes + access to Balnéa, so you can wind down after your skiing adventure!
